gpt4 book ai didi

php - 使用 PHP 解析字符串以按行组织

转载 作者:行者123 更新时间:2023-11-29 14:59:41 25 4
gpt4 key购买 nike

这可能是很容易完成的事情。我的 MySQL 数据库中有一些日期(并且我正在使用 PHP)。有些存储为 2010-08-25 11:00:00,而其他存储为 2010-08-25T08:00:00

我的问题是:我从数据库中选择日期,然后使用 ORDER BY start_date

但是,我注意到当日期字符串包含“T”时,它会将其按顺序向下推。例如,我返回的日期是:

 2010-08-25 11:00:00
2010-08-25 14:15:00
2010-08-25T08:00:00
2010-08-25T14:30:00
2010-08-25T15:00:00

如您所见,上午 8 点的事件会在下午 2:15 的事件之后显示。

关于如何重新安排以便将上午 8 点的事件移至顶部,您有什么想法吗?

谢谢。

最佳答案

您始终可以将日期列表导入 PHP,使用字符串函数将“T”转换为空格,然后对列表进行排序。

但这绝对不是一个好的解决方案。如果可能的话,最好修复数据库中的数据。

关于php - 使用 PHP 解析字符串以按行组织,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3566846/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com